January 22nd Celebrated History

1946

President Harry S. Truman signs a directive creating the Central Intelligence Group, the predecessor to the Central Intelligence Agency.

1968

The sketch comedy television show, Rowan and Martin's Laugh-In, premiers on NBC. Comedians Dan Rowan and Dick Martin hosted the show for five years.

1984

During a Super Bowl XVIII commercial, the Apple Macintosh computer is introduced. It is the first home computer to utilize a mouse and graphical user interface.

1992

Aboard the space shuttle Discovery, the first Canadian woman and first neurologist launched into space. Dr. Roberta Bondar began her training in 1984 with the Canadian Space Agency.

1997

The United States Senate confirmed Madeleine Albright as the first female United States Secretary of State. President Bill Clinton appointed her to the Cabinet position, and she served until January 20, 2001.

January 22nd Celebrated Birthdays

Justina Laurena Carter Ford - 1871

Shortly after earning her medical degree from Hering Medical School in Chicago, Ford became the first African American woman to obtain a medical license in Colorado. However, since all the hospitals in Denver denied her privileges, she opened her own practice.

Willa Brown - 1906

In 1938, Brown became the first African American woman to earn a pilot license in the United States - 17 years after Bessie Coleman earned hers in France. A year later, Brown obtained her commercial license.

Sam Cooke - 1935

The gospel singer earned the title "father of soul" in the 1950s. Some of his most popular songs include "Twistin' the Night Away," "You Send Me," and "Chain Gang."

Beryl Swain - 1936

In 1907, the International Auto-Cycle Tourist Trophy race commenced. At the time it was a 15-mile race on the Isle of Man - an island between Ireland and England. Today, it is considered the world's most dangerous motorcycle race at 38 miles and is known as the Isle of Man Tourist Trophy race. In 1962, Beryl Swain became the first woman to compete in the race. She completed the race 22nd out of 25 racers.
